"[4] The Secretary of the Army or a major commander may award this medal for outstanding service that makes a substantial contribution or is of significance to the major Army command concerned.
Superimposed on the triangle is the eagle from the Great Seal of the United States.
The reverse of the medal is inscribed AWARDED TO and FOR MERITORIOUS PUBLIC SERVICE TO THE UNITED STATES ARMY.
[2] The medal is suspended by a ribbon 1+3⁄8 in (35 mm) in width consisting of 13 alternating stripes equally spaced, seven white and six red.
